Ok, i just number your questions.

#1- No you dont even though it makes it prettier IMO.

#2- They dont need any specific light. The light is for the plants not the frogs.

#3- Cant remember sites name but if i do i will come back and post it.

#4- Hopefully it is not that cold in your house but you can put a submersible aquarium heater in the water of the terrarium and between that and the lights you should be fine on tips.

#5- I would have a glass lid as it will keep the humidity and temps up.

#6- No it wont but make sure its real shallow.

I did read somewhere that you could feed them flightless fruit flies which I think you can breed (not 100% sure tho) and they'd probably be quieter than crickets if that came to be an issue, although etunes probably knows more about them than I do lol.
 
flying fruit flies are super easy to breed, just leave fruit out. I'd imagine flightless fruit flies would be even easier. 1 container, add flies, add fruit and wait a day. The hard part would be finding brood stock.

Man, you guys beat me to it. I meant to put that in my second post. Yes, flightless fruitflies are a GREAT food for the darts. They are small and easy to eat and are easier to breed then crickets and are quieter. They also contain very good nutrition.
